You need to strip the clearcoat off before you can polish them. Aircraft stripper will take it right off. After that, polish them with what ever method suits you. I prefer to take 'em off the bike and polish them on my bench buffer.
All of you aluminum can polished the same way....I certainly like my polished aluminum.
